Over the years, many fans have wondered if there was a deleted scene in "Sandy Duncan's Jekyll and Hydes," due to Shaggy mentioning running into King Kong, despite that we never actually see it happen. Some official confirmation that there was originally a scene featuring King Kong has surfaced online. One of the character designers for the show, Alex Toth, released a book titled Genius in 2014. In a preview of this book, a drawing of King Kong is included, with the storyboard labeled as being from "Sandy Duncan's Jekyll and Hydes."
Bleeding Cool has announced that in an upcoming Teen Titans Go! season 8 episode, Scooby-Doo will make an appearance. The episode will center around the Teen Titans visiting WB-Discovery Studios to celebrate the 100th anniversary. Scooby was not explicitly mentioned in the press release, but a picture of Scooby, Shaggy and Fred was included, confirming that they will appear in this episode. It is unknown if Daphne and Velma will also appear. They will also be teaming up with other classic Hanna-Barbera characters including The Jetsons, The Flintstones, Magilla Gorilla, Yogi and Boo Boo Bear, Wally Gator, and Quick Draw McGraw. There are currently no details regarding whether Scooby and the gang just make a brief cameo, or if they have a larger role in the episode. The episode will air September 23, 2023 at 9:30am (the timezone is not specified, but I presume it's Eastern Standard Time).
Two brand new Scooby-Doo picture book series have been announced on Barnes & Noble's website, titled Scooby-Doo Explores and Scooby-Doo! Space Adventures. Four books were announced for each series. Scooby-Doo! Space Adventures by Ailynn Collins will be released on August 1, 2023. Ailynn Collins. The books in the series are titled Spotting Stars and Constellations with Velma, Exploring Planets and Dwarf Planets with Velma, Investigating the Milky Way and Other Galaxies with Velma, Tracking Meteors, Astroids and Comets with Velma. Scooby-Doo Explores by John Sazaklis will be released in January 2024, and are titled Habitats, Cities, Transportation, and The Neighborhood. The books will be published by Capstone. In the comments on the YouTube video for the trailer, WB confirmed that the film will be released on September 26, 2023 on DVD and October 24, 2023 on digital. The DVD will include three superhero-themed bonus episodes from Scooby-Doo and Guess Who?, including "The Scooby of a Thousand Faces!", "What a Night, for a Dark Knight!" and "One Minute Mysteries!"

HotStuffForGeeks has announced that a brand new limited edition Funko Pop Scooby-Doo figure will be released at this year's San Diego Comic Con. The figure is named "Scuba Scooby," featuring Scooby-Doo in his scuba gear that he wore in "A Clue for Scooby-Doo" from Scooby-Doo, Where Are You?. The figure will be available to purchase for $15 on Funko's website beginning Thursday, July 20 at 8:00am CST. These figures are known to sell out fast, most prominently highlighted by limited edition Hex Girls Funko Pops selling out eight minutes after they were made available on Funko's site.
